The Texas Rangers are set to go head-to-head with the Houston Astros at Minute Maid Park on July 14, 2024, with the first pitch scheduled for 2:10 PM. Cloudy skies are expected for the game day.

The starting pitcher for the Texas Rangers has not been confirmed yet. For the Astros, Ronel Blanco will take the mound, boasting an ERA of 2.534.

In the 2024 AL West Division, the Rangers are ranked 11th with a record of 45-50, a winning percentage of .47. Their division record stands at 12-16, placing them 3rd in the AL West. The Rangers have picked up 6 wins in their last 10 outings and are currently riding a one-game winning streak. At home, their record is 24-21, while away they have 21 wins and 29 losses. They perform better in night games with 27 wins as opposed to 18 in day games. Over the season, they have scored 410 runs and conceded 403.

Meanwhile, the Astros hold the 8th position with a 50-45 record, translating to a .53 winning percentage. They are 2nd in the division with a 16-13 record against divisional rivals. The Astros have 7 victories in their last 10 matches, though they come into this game off a loss. They boast a stronger home record of 28-20 compared to 22-25 on the road. Their performance in night games is notable with 33 wins against 17 in day games. The Astros have accumulated 455 runs while allowing 404 runs.
